Full Job Description
The Senior Financial Analyst will provide financial and analytical support to Mosaic's support functions. This person will lead routine cost reporting, lead meetings with functional leadership and employees, and provide direct support to function Vice Presidents and their employees for ad hoc analysis and projects. In addition, this person will lead the global budget process for support functions, provide support for the strategic planning process, provide both support and leadership roles in a number of value-add projects and process improvements for the support functions.

What will you do?
  • Lead routine reporting approaches for the various corporate support functions, which includes understanding the needs of the function leader and their respective mangers. Lead routine meetings and gather, analyze, and present meaningful information. Maintain accountability for foundational reporting with special attention to the quality of information and analysis provided as well as the efficiency in which it is processed. Identify and lead process improvement efforts.
  • Lead the budget and forecast processes for the global support functions. Leadership will be required to communicate with all levels of the organization, execute related process improvements, and meet the expectations for analysis of costs. Provide indirect support to the forecast, Strategic Planning process, and other deliverables required by the Finance Business Partnership Team.
  • In working with the support functions, identify cost savings, service improvements, and other value-add opportunities. Gather information and create analysis that will yield improvements that are meaningful to customers.
  • Build relationships and network with customers at all levels within the functional organizations to understand their perspectives on the Finance business partner role, which will lead to a deeper understanding of the functions and value-add ideas for improving the functions and the quality of our support.

About The Mosaic Company

The Mosaic Company is a producer and marketer of concentrated phosphate and potash crop nutrients. Mosaic is the largest producer of finished phosphate products in North America and one of the largest potash producers in the world. The company also owns and operates mines in South America and has investments in fertilizer production operations in China. Mosaic is headquartered in Plymouth, Minnesota, and has operations in six countries.
